INDIANAPOLIS — Police say a suitcase containing human remains has been found near a creek in Indianapolis. Department spokeswoman Officer Genae Cook tells The Indianapolis Star that several people were walking along Bean Creek on the city’s southeast side Monday afternoon when they found the suitcase. She says one of the people opened the suitcase